Jonas' father is a Nurturer in The Giver. At the beginning of the story, Jonas' understanding of the job of Nurturer is that he cares for the newborn babies.
His character and job become important in the story when Jonas becomes the Receiver and is able to understand further what his father's job entails. Jonas sees his father take a set of twins, compare their weight and health, and "release" the smaller of the twins. This is an important moment in the narrative because it is a loss of innocence for Jonas, and he also realizes that his father is not the man he believed him to be. This is one of the moments that changes Jonas' view of the community and ultimately leads to the decision of taking the baby Gabriel and leaving.
